Imagine that your appliances have the ability to power up or down, in real time, based on up-to-the-minute electricity costs. An SOA-based marketplace proves the possibility

In this SOA project, called GridWise, PNNL and IBM built an event-driven architecture that allows customers to control electricity consumption in real time.

What if IT could be used to eliminate the West Coast’s notorious rolling blackouts or huge regional power outages like those experienced by the Northeast and Midwest in 2003?
